Exam Overview
The AP Computer Science Principles Exam assesses student understanding of the computational thinking practices and learning objectives outlined in the course framework. The AP Exam consists of the Create performance task and an end-of-course exam. For more information, download the AP Computer Science Principles Course and Exam Description(CED). Exam Format
The AP Computer Science Principles end-of-course exam has consistent question types and weighting every year, so you and your students know what to expect on exam day.
Section I: End-of-Course Multiple-Choice Exam
70 multiple-choice questions | 120 minutes | 70% of score | 4 answer options
- 57 single-select multiple-choice
- 5 single-select with reading passage about a computing innovation
- 8 multiple-select multiple-choice: select 2 answers
Section II: Create Performance Task: Written Responses
30% of score
- Create performance task program code, video, and student-authored Personalized Project Reference | 9 hours in-class
- 4 written response prompts | 60 minutes end-of-course exam
The second section of the AP Computer Science Principles Exam consists of a through-course Create performance task where students will develop a computer program of their choice and an end-of-course written response section where students demonstrate their understanding of their personal Create performance task by answering four prompts. Students will be provided 9 hours of in-class time to complete their program, video, and develop a Personalized Project Reference.
For the written response prompts, students will have access to their Personalized Project Reference and write responses to four prompts related to their program and code contained in this reference sheet. One question from each of the prompt categories listed below will appear on the end-of-course exam. The specific prompts will vary across the different versions of the exam.
